The "crab" is a cursive "L" in an ordnance "bomb" which is the gun proof of Liege, Belgium. It was required on guns of foreign make sold in Belgium after 1924. I do not know if it is still a requirement, or if Belgium now accepts definitive proofs from other EU countries.
